当前位置: 首页 > news >正文

如何用Python自动处理Excel,让加班见鬼去

前言

凌晨1点,你还在复制粘贴第87张表格。眼睛干涩,手腕酸痛,明天还要交报告。而隔壁组的同事,却总能在下班前准时消失——直到我发现,他的秘密武器是7行Python代码。

一、你的痛苦,Python最懂

合并100个Excel文件:手动?至少3小时。Python?1分钟

清洗混乱数据:查找替换到手抽筋?Python精准定位

生成可视化报表:复制→粘贴→调整格式?Python一键输出

二、核心武器:pandas库

python

安装:在终端输入 pip install pandas openpyxl

import pandas as pd

魔法开始——读取Excel

df = pd.read_excel(‘销售数据.xlsx’)
print(f"成功加载!表格有 {df.shape[0]} 行,{df.shape[1]} 列")

3秒看懂你的数据

print(df.head()) # 看前5行
print(df.describe()) # 数值型数据统计摘要

三、实战:一键合并全年12个月报表

假设你有:1月销售.xlsx、2月销售.xlsx……12月销售.xlsx

python
import pandas as pd
import os

1. 找到所有Excel文件

excel_files = [f for f in os.listdir(‘.’) if f.endswith(‘.xlsx’) and ‘销售’ in f]
print(f"找到 {len(excel_files)} 个月份的数据文件")

2. 逐个读取并合并(核心3行!)

all_data = []
for file in excel_files:
df = pd.read_excel(file)
df[‘月份’] = file[:2] # 添加月份列
all_data.append(df)

3. 合并成一个大数据表

final_df = pd.concat(all_data, ignore_index=True)

4. 保存结果

final_df.to_excel(‘2025全年销售总表.xlsx’, index=False)
print(“✅ 合并完成!文件已保存”)
运行结果:原本需要加班3小时的工作,现在不到10秒完成。

四、更多“偷懒”技能包

python

1. 智能清洗:删除空行、重复项

clean_df = final_df.dropna().drop_duplicates()

2. 高级筛选:找出销售额>10000的记录

big_orders = final_df[final_df[‘销售额’] > 10000]

3. 智能分组:按月统计总额

monthly_sum = final_df.groupby(‘月份’)[‘销售额’].sum()

4. 保存多个Sheet到同一文件

with pd.ExcelWriter(‘分析报告.xlsx’) as writer:
final_df.to_excel(writer, sheet_name=‘原始数据’, index=False)
monthly_sum.to_excel(writer, sheet_name=‘月度汇总’)
big_orders.to_excel(writer, sheet_name=‘大额订单’)

五、你的自动化工作流

把以上代码保存为excel_auto.py,以后只需要:

把Excel文件放到同一个文件夹

双击运行脚本

喝杯咖啡,等待完成

六、从今天开始改变

立即行动:复制上面的合并代码,替换文件名试试

延伸学习:

需要格式美化?学习openpyxl

需要邮件自动发送?学习smtplib

需要定时运行?学习schedule

记住:你不是被Excel困住,你只是还没告诉Python该怎么做。每一次手动重复,都是对生命的浪费;而每一行自动化的代码,都是给自己买回的时间。

现在,打开那个让你加班到凌晨的Excel文件,想想它哪里最折磨你——然后,用Python终结它。

如果这篇文章帮你看到了“准时下班”的希望,请点赞/收藏支持! 在评论区留下你最想自动化的Excel任务,下一篇教程也许就是为你量身定制。今晚,准时下班。

http://www.jsqmd.com/news/342276/

相关文章:

  • 靠谱 AI 论文生成软件排行榜(学生党 / 科研党专属)
  • 2026靠谱 PCB电路板供应商 top5 榜单,大中小批量、高端制造全覆盖 - 资讯焦点
  • 给APP添加模拟点击功能+手电筒功能+经纬度+手机投屏功能
  • PaperRed 文献黑科技:百篇文献一键梳理,文献综述高效生成
  • 选型必看!2026PCB板生产厂家推荐,这家PCB板好用品质高! - 资讯焦点
  • 4.3 实验:LoRA/QLoRA微调模型实现业务风格定制
  • 医院陪护新帮手,JAVA陪诊系统一键解忧
  • 创建key store
  • 实测分享:夏杰语音性能资源深度解析,轻量高效适配全场景
  • 墨蝌签名平台保姆级使用教程(www.moooke.com/)上
  • 汽车制造智能体如何破解数据孤岛?智能体协同作战案例
  • 线上配资平台的推荐-2026年线上配资平台哪个好?权威十大品牌优缺点终极推荐 - 资讯焦点
  • 1.Body-force-weighted方式:适用于有显著的body force的计算(如重力、离心力、磁力)
  • 性价比影像仪推荐 10 大品牌值得入 - 博客万
  • 从成员初始化列表开始,彻底理解 C++ 对象的一生
  • 线上实盘配资与实盘配资软件-2026年榜单:线上实盘配资平台哪个好?五大品牌优缺点深度评价 - 资讯焦点
  • 贵州装修公司实测推荐:基于1500+用户反馈的客观筛选 - GEO排行榜
  • 赛脉笛借助订单日记实现降本增效双突破
  • 电脑加密软件有哪些好用?5款电脑加密软件推荐,2026电脑加密软件排行榜
  • 适配点胶工艺的超声波流量传感器推荐:满足多场景流量测量需求 - 品牌2025
  • 从远端服务器请求数据,并且完善员工管理列表
  • 计算机PHP毕设实战-基于php+vue的课程在线考试系统的设计与实现课程管理、班级管理、题库管理【完整源码+LW+部署说明+演示视频,全bao一条龙等】
  • 实盘配资排行榜-2026最新实盘配资品牌推荐榜:十强优缺点深度评测,哪个好? - 资讯焦点
  • 写不出大纲?保姆级教程:手把手带你搭建高逻辑毕业论文框架
  • 6.6 Bookinfo可观测性实战:分布式追踪、指标监控、日志聚合完整方案
  • 达州市英语雅思培训机构推荐;2026权威测评出国雅思辅导机构口碑榜单 - 老周说教育
  • 广安市英语雅思培训机构推荐,2026权威测评出国雅思辅导机构口碑榜单 - 老周说教育
  • 达州市英语雅思培训机构推荐:2026权威测评出国雅思辅导机构口碑榜单 - 老周说教育
  • 6.4 微服务熔断限流实战:用Istio保护核心业务服务
  • GEO时代来临:软文推广平台的转型之路与未来格局